Description

Well, I don’t have to say much, but I try to keep it short :).

Finnaly done – it’s my first tileset, and i’ll tried to make him to look quite nice, but the most important thing is i wanted to show, that you can make a tileset using only paint and JJ2 basic pallete (32colors)! I know, it’s quite incredible, but ALL tileset has been created using winodws paint program (everything without the background, that was made in Terralogic texture maker).

I took one bite into it and realized that it was sadly under-cooked. Enough metaphor, let’s get to the review. Look: It’s kinda like tube-electric. Except it’s much lower quality. It has thankfully, all of the basic tiles. It has something that cought me way off gaurd. A textured background. Made in paint. And it looks great. Only two animating tiles, but that’s lot more than some tilesets out there. Water is included, but looks out of place in an industrial tileset. Overall: The tileset looks…paintish, but dosen’t look flat thankfully. Some out of place tiles. Nice BG. Ease to use: Sort of easy to use. Some of the tiles can look like others, so you may use the wrong tile in places and spend a minute or two trying to figure out why it looks that way. The invisible block isn’t invisibile D=. It can only be used when in a certain background. Some tiles…I just how no idea what they are. Overall: Sort of easy to use. Diversity: Hmm, it’s bascially…industrial. Red based with grey ness or grey based with red ness. Dosen’t get more different than that. Overall: Not very diverse.

FINAL NOTES: Technos had a good first impression, but when you got down to the details it dosen’t preform well. 6.5

But anyway, ‘Technos’ is as tacky and generic as it’s name is. It has two types of ground. A brick ground, that is just a pure gradient, no texture. Tip next time- add textures to your blocks. There is also a very plain grey ground, that has edges that grow lighter (I generally find it is smart to make it grow ligher as it gets farther into the block). Both types of ground can have holes in it or be cracked to some extent. Oh, and the brick ground can have a yellow-black striped thing on it, that looks OK. There is also two animations that have this glowing, shifting, light thing, and neither look too good. Plus all the arrows, the text sign, and this ugly light thingy are animated. There are spikes, window things, wires (tubelectricky, but not as good), vines (which are chains and look OK), hooks, text signs, sucker tubes, and destruct blocks. There are also there wierd things above the sucker tubes that I have no idea what they are suppost to be. But really, the best thing about this tileset is it’s textured BG.
